Staying Aware #5: Bloodborne Pathogens

Safety Corner

As we have all become more in-tune with key health & safety protocols as a result of the Covid-19 pandemic, it’s also important to be vigilant around potential bloodborne pathogens (BBPs).

Being aware of the appropriate precautions to take to protect yourself and understanding the steps necessary to address potential exposure can protect your health and safety. BBPs can be transmitted via open wounds or membranes in your eyes, nose or mouth. Wear gloves/masks as appropriate and wash your hands and the affected areas if exposed.
